Nigeria Top Celebrities Gather For The Macallan Sherry Oak Launch In Lagos

Posted on September 13, 2023

Some of the country’s biggest stars gathered at the Mantra Restaurant and Lounge, VI, Lagos, on Friday, to celebrate with world-renowned Scotch whisky brand, The Macallan, as its Sherry Oak 25 & 30 Years Old arrived in Nigeria.

Only 35 selected guests from the business circles and the entertainment scene including ex-BBNaija star Prince Nelson, media personality, Moet Abebe; renowned fashion designer, Mai Atafo; Nigeria TV host, Bolanle Olukanni etc., were hosted on a sensorial journey.

As the evening began, guests walked in through ornate traditional Arabian doors and stepped into The Macallan’s timelapse while surrounded by antique European-Asian furniture, intricate wall designs, and earthy tones.

Anticipation for the unveiling of the time-honoured whiskies heightened as cocktails and canapes flowed in the room.

The excitement then reached a climax as the Sherry Oak 25 and 30 YO whiskies were presented in an exquisite whisky-tasting session steered by the brand ambassadors – Adeyinka Adepetun and Daniel Atteh.

The night was made even more memorable with a sensational performance by Aituaje ‘Waje’ Iruobe.

The singer’s distinct melodies thrilled the guests as they savoured every sip, seamlessly complementing the excellent craftsmanship synonymous with the Scotch brand.

Amid the quality music, the guests mingled effortlessly, forming connections and displaying exceptional whisky knowledge.

As glasses clinked and conversations flowed throughout the evening, it was evident that this was another experience that would last in the memories of the attendees for years to come.

Mai Atafo said: “Every moment of my time here was absolutely enchanting. I relished the delightful blend of soul-stirring music, delectable cuisine, and the company of great people. The Macallan Sherry Oak 30 YO was the highlight of my night.”

The Macallan has reaffirmed its position as a pioneer in the world of whisky, pushing boundaries and setting benchmarks for what a truly remarkable whisky soirée can be.

The Scotch whisky brand had previously unveiled its M Collection and Harmony Collection Inspired by Intense Arabica in Nigeria as part of its dedication to sharing its legacy of exceptional craftsmanship and taste with whisky lovers in the country.
